KULGAM, OCTOBER 17: On the concluding day of Poshan Mah 2024, District Programme Office Poshan Projects Kulgam in collaboration with District Administration Kulgam today organised a mega programme at village Qaimoh in Poshan Project HS Bugh.

The Deputy Commissioner (DC) Kulgam, Athar Amir Khan presided over the programme, which was attended by District Programme Officer Poshan Kulgam, Abdul Rashid Dass, Tehsildar Qaimoh, CDPO HS Bugh, BMO Qaimoh, supervisors and AWWs.

The District Programme Officer Poshan Project Kulgam presented a detailed overview of the schemes implemented by the Department. He assured 100% achievement in the targets set by the Department and directed the field functionaries to tirelessly work till desired targets are achieved.

On the occasion, the DC flagged-off the IEC Van to raise awareness among the masses regarding schemes executed by the ICDS Department. He also checked the stalls installed by the ICDS and Health departments.

The DC passed on directions to the ICDS and Health Officers /officials to identify the SAM, MAM, underweight, and Anaemic beneficiaries for immediate redressal. He also highlighted the importance of ICDS and Health Services for the welfare of the common masses.

On spot Anemia testing of 69 beneficiaries including children, Pregnant Ladies and Lactating Mothers was also done by the Health Department in which 09 beneficiaries were found Anemic and referred to Health Department for immediate treatment.
